Transaction 940512527a3eadd394b37890b4f79d3847a974f3f3efb0d24a81bb78e976f093
1 Input
1 Output
-
940512527a3eadd394b37890b4f79d3847a974f3f3efb0d24a81bb78e976f093:0
- value
- 21754931
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cbcdf6cad328aeb392534bd88c3b12798315992 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FHkg2znfegCNKz6QzyrR9YV9BneijxusA